I was getting trace/breakpoint traps from my new 2.4.9-pa24 kernel
and it was suggested that I recompile the kernel for PA7100 (not 8000
as I had done before.) I was unable to compile the kernel again
while running 2.4.9 so I had to boot the 2.4.0 kernel that was included
on the 0.92 CD. When that kernel was running I was able to recompile
the 2.4.9 kernel again and it's now working much better. Im now able
to compile things with out any (unusual) errors.
However, I again had a rather massive filesystem corruption on my root
filesystem after I had been running 2.4.0. I had to manually run fsck
and answer "y" to 50 - 60 "fix?" questions.
